Output f3d73228fa3b7dd702fe51f83dba3c34dea1ec5c0cf624370926272605d7bc51:0

value
606252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71b49f2e5a83be39bea83d97a907fb807e8f3f2b OP_EQUAL
address
3C4Ef3U44sfTTJc5kKHdMURoM23JkZAnp1
transaction
f3d73228fa3b7dd702fe51f83dba3c34dea1ec5c0cf624370926272605d7bc51
confirmations
330312
spent
true